Brodmann Area Maps (BA Maps)

The [http://www.nmr.mgh.harvard.edu/martinos/noFlashHome.php Martinos Center for Biomedical Imaging] and the [http://www.fz-juelich.de/inb/inb-3/Home Institute of Neurosciences and Biophysics (INB)] have created an atlas of a subset of the Brodmann Areas, for usage in Freesurfer for automated parcellation.

Labels

The following labels [https://surfer.nmr.mgh.harvard.edu/pub/dist/ba_labels_fsaverage.tar.gz are available for download] and display on the 'fsaverage' surface distributed with Freesurfer:

  • ?h.BA1
  • ?h.BA2
  • ?h.BA3a
  • ?h.BA3b
  • ?h.BA4a
  • ?h.BA4p
  • ?h.BA6
  • ?h.BA44
  • ?h.BA45
  • ?h.V1
  • ?h.V2
  • ?h.MT

Copy the file [https://surfer.nmr.mgh.harvard.edu/pub/dist/ba_labels_fsaverage.tar.gz ba_labels_fsaverage.tar.gz] to your $FREESURFER_HOME/subjects/fsaverage/labels directory, then type tar zxvf ba_labels_fsaverage.tar.gz to extract. To view a label, open an inflated surface (tksurfer fsaverage lh inflated) and then select File->Label->Load Label and select a label (lh.BA1.label, for example). Then select Tools->Labels->Copy Label Statistics to Overlay, then select View->Configure->Overlay and set Min threshold to 0 and Max threshold to 0.5, also select Linear threshold, and then press Apply. The label should appear on the surface. Only one label at a time can be displayed.

References

  • [https://surfer.nmr.mgh.harvard.edu/ftp/articles/ba_maps2007.pdf Cortical Folding Patterns and Predicting Cytoarchitecture], Fischl, B., N. Rajendran, E. Busa, J. Augustinack, O. Hinds, B.T.T. Yeo, H. Mohlberg, K. Amunts, K. Zilles, (2007). Cerebral Cortex 2007, doi:10.1093/cercor/bhm225.

  • [https://surfer.nmr.mgh.harvard.edu/ftp/articles/hinds2007accurate.pdf Accurate prediction of V1 location from cortical folds in a surface coordinate system], Hinds, O.P., N. Rajendran, J.R. Polimeni, J.C. Augustinack, G. Wiggins, L.L. Wald, H.D. Rosas, A. Potthast, E.L. Schwartz and B. Fischl (2007). NeuroImage 2007.10.033.

  • Quantitative analysis of cyto- and receptor architecture of the human brain, Zilles K, Schleicher A, Palomero-Gallagher N, Amunts K (2002). Brain Mapping: The Methods, edited by J. C. Mazziotta and A. Toga, USA: Elsevier, 2002, p. 573-602.
  • Cytoarchitecture of the cerebral cortex - more than localization, Amunts K, Schleicher A, Zilles K (2007). NeuroImage 37:1061-1065.

  • Towards multimodal atlases of the human brain, Toga AW, Thompson PM, Mori S, Amunts K, Zilles K (2006). Nature Neuroscience Reviews, 7(12):952-966.
  • Gender-specific left-right asymmetries in human visual cortex, Amunts K, Armstrong E, Malikovic A, Hoemke L, Mohlberg H, Schleicher A, Zilles K (2007). The Journal of Neuroscience, 27(6):1356-1364.
